The Thurgood Marshall College Fund (TMCF) Scholars Program – Professional Alumni Development Cohort is a selective professional development experience designed to support HBCU graduates as they advance within their careers and leadership journeys. This cohort-based program offers emerging and established professionals structured opportunities to refine their leadership competencies, strengthen strategic thinking, and expand their access to high-impact professional networks. Grounded in TMCF’s commitment to lifelong leadership development, the program equips participants with practical tools and insights necessary to navigate evolving workplace environments, lead within complex organizational systems, and position themselves for sustained career growth. Through curated learning sessions, peer engagement, and industry-informed development experiences, scholars will deepen their capacity to lead with clarity, adaptability, and influence. This experience emphasizes applied leadership, professional agility, and network cultivation, recognizing that career advancement is shaped not only by technical expertise but by decision-making, communication, and relationship-building capabilities. Participants will engage in collaborative discussions, executive-level development exercises, and reflective learning designed to translate directly into their professional contexts. The Professional Alumni Development Cohort reflects TMCF’s broader mission to support talent beyond graduation, reinforcing the long-term impact of HBCU excellence across industries, sectors, and leadership pathways.
